GILMER COUNTY, Ga. – A man, alleged to be a dangerous hitchhiker, has been taken into custody in Union County today.
On Nov. 30, Jordan Hedden and Stephanie Neace were hitchhiking when a Cherokee County citizen picked up the pair.
According to reports, after Hedden entered the vehicle, he kidnapped the citizen, forcing her into the backseat and then took over her car.
Warrants were issued for Both Hedden and Neace.
Neace was identified and arrested in Georgia. Hedden evaded police for days, and was believed to have entered a Tennessee residence with a firearm during this time.
He later hitchhiked into Georgia where he was identified and arrested today, Dec. 4, in Union County.
